New Office Administrator

We are very excited to introduce our new Office Administrator, Colleen Munson! She comes with a wealth of experience in church administration and a generosity of spirit that makes her a wonderful teammate. We are delighted to have her as the newest member of our UUCSW staff team!

Colleen can be reached at both office@uucsw.org and colleen.munson@uucsw.org

Colleen has been an active member of the First Unitarian Church of Worcester since 2007. She has worked for several years in church administration, and currently also works at St. Michael’s on-the-Heights Episcopal Church in Worcester. She is looking forward to combining her professional and spiritual life by bringing her administrative skills into a UUA congregation!

Colleen lives in Worcester and is the proud mom of three young men who are 21, 18, and 17; and is happy to have another 18-year-old young man living in their home, as well. Her biggest social justice passion is disability rights, particularly autism awareness. She taught yoga for 11 years and specialized in teaching classes for people with disabilities. Colleen has been a choir girl most of her life and enjoys all kinds of music. She’s also a huge baseball fan!
